Trump frequently announces he's halting strikes in Iran. But they keep happening

  • Trump has repeatedly threatened massive strikes on Iran only to pause them at the last minute, creating a pattern of abrupt back-and-forth announcements.
  • Those flip-flops have helped drive up oil and basic goods prices and disrupted shipping through the strategic Strait of Hormuz.
  • His latest move: he says he will halt new planned attacks while renewed talks aim to wind down the war and reopen cargo traffic.
